What Is Automotive Catalog Gap Analysis?
Gap and coverage analysis is the foundational capability of Clarity Analytics. It answers the most basic and most important question in catalog management: for every vehicle on the road, does your catalog have the part that vehicle needs?
​
The answer requires matching your ACES catalog applications against the full VIO universe, vehicle by vehicle, part type by part type, across every market you serve. Done manually, that is a weeks-long project with a high error rate. Done with Clarity's automotive catalog gap analysis tool, it runs automatically every time your catalog updates.

How Does Clarity Calculate Catalog Coverage?
Clarity builds an analytics model around your catalog using configurable scope criteria specific to your product category. It evaluates every vehicle application in your ACES catalog and classifies each vehicle in the VIO base. The result is a coverage percentage calculated at the vehicle level — not the application level — so overlap across sub-brands is handled correctly and double-counting is eliminated.
​
Vehicles are classified into four categories:
​
Covered: Vehicles covered by at least one application in your catalog.
Holes: Vehicles within scope but with no matching application in your catalog, ranked by VIO volume. These are your ACES coverage gaps.
Research Items: Vehicles flagged for further review before a coverage determination can be made.
Not Required: Vehicles excluded from coverage requirements based on model configuration.
